HARRY STOCKWELL
Noted Singer and actor 'Harry Stockwell' was born on April 27, 1902. He is best known for playing the Prince in Snow White. He did very few roles. However, he brought up two talented actors, Dean Stockwell and Guy Stockwell. His former wife, Nina Olivette is an actress of the 30's, who still lives in California. He was also notable in the theater, especially on Broadway. Every play was a musical, and he usually got an important part. He was the star of Broadway's ''Oaklahoma'', as Curly from March 31, 1943- May 29, 1948. He had to replace Alfred Drake, who was the original lead. Reportedly, Harry Stockwell was reported to have been married before he wed Nina Olivette, but he rarely had mentioned it in his correspondence.
